Plumber Salary in Utah

How Plumbers in Utah get paid in 2026 — median, range, experience tiers, metro breakdown, and a comparison against national pay.

$74,200
Median annual Plumber salary in Utah, Q1 2026 projection.
That's +$1,400 (+2%) above the national median of $72,800.
Range: $56,400 (P25) → $96,500 (P75) → $122,500 (P90).

Plumber Salary by Experience in Utah

Pay tiers reflect typical Utah compensation across career stages. Specialized employers may pay above these ranges.

ExperienceMedian 202625th %75th %
Entry (0–1 yr)$51,900$39,400$67,500
Junior (2–4 yrs)$64,500$49,000$83,900
Mid-Level (5–9 yrs)$74,200$56,400$96,500
Senior (10–14 yrs)$89,000$67,600$115,800
Veteran (15+ yrs)$100,900$76,700$131,200

Plumber Salary in Utah: FAQ

What is the average Plumber salary in Utah?

The average Plumber salary in Utah is $74,200 per year as of 2026, based on projections from BLS Occupational Employment Statistics. The 25th percentile sits at $56,400 and the 75th at $96,500.

Is Utah a good state for Plumbers?

Pay-wise, Utah sits +2% above the national Plumber median ($72,800). Pay tracks roughly with the national average — cost of living is the deciding factor for take-home purchasing power.

How much do senior Plumbers earn in Utah?

Senior Plumbers (10–14 years of experience) in Utah earn around $89,000 per year on average. Veterans with 15+ years can reach $100,900 or more, especially at the 75th percentile and above.

How does Utah compare to other states for Plumber pay?

Among all 51 jurisdictions (50 states + DC), Utah ranks 23rd for Plumber pay. The highest-paying state pays around $106,200 on average.
